Another party today?

This site can’t be reached setiathome.berkeley.edu’s server IP address could not be found.
No - both the website and the operational servers are working fine from here.

If that message means that your machine can't work out what IP address to use ("Can't resolve hostname" in the Event log), then it's a local DNS failure at your ISP and can be overcome by activating the hosts file. If the IP address is being resolved (check with <http_debug>), then it's a routing problem between your machine and Berkeley - not a lot you can do about that except contact the ISP and complain.

My current list is

# 208.68.240.118	setiboincdata.ssl.berkeley.edu	# upload server Aug 2017
# 208.68.240.110	boinc2.ssl.berkeley.edu		# download server Aug 2017
# 208.68.240.126	setiboinc.ssl.berkeley.edu	# scheduler Aug 2017
# 208.68.240.127	boinc2.ssl.berkeley.edu		# download server Aug 2017
# 208.68.240.110	setiathome.berkeley.edu		# website Aug 2017
You only want to un-comment one of the two download servers at a time.
